As far as plug-ins go we have come across the WP-Sticky plug-in that sticks posts that you want to highlight for a day or two. I haven’t tried the plug-in yet but it seems like something fun to try out. I have been updating quite a bit lately and have found some of my more interesting posts are falling to page 2 rather quickly. So I’ll probably dabble with this plug-in later in the weekend.
I’ve also installed a do-follow plug-in. All this time I thought Wordpress allowed do-follow but apparently most blogging platforms automatically convert links to no follow unless you override the coding. I feel that if you leave relevant comments on my blog that you should be allowed to take credit for the links back to your site.
